SHILLONG: The UDP is likely to decide on whether to continue its support to the Congress-led Khasi Hills United Democratic Alliance (KHUDA) in the KHADC after it receives a detailed report from the leader of the KHADC Parliamentary Party, Remington Pyngrope over the political developments in the Council.

The UDP has sought a detailed report from Pyngrope on the issue, UDP working president Paul Lyngdoh said here on Tuesday.

Lyngdoh said that the Parliamentary party is scheduled to meet on Wednesday after the State Election Committee meeting. “A clear picture will emerge by tomorrow,” he added.

Earlier on Monday, the three HSPDP MDCs had withdrawn their support from the Congress-led alliance in the KHADC.he decision of three HSPDP MDCs — LG Nongsiej, KP Pangngiang and Enbin K Raswai — to withdraw support came as a surprise since Pangngiang and Nongsiej had voted against the resolution on ILP during the Council’s Autumn session recently.
